In a first track process, we look together with your employer at what is possible for you within the company. Often, this is more than you and your employer might think. We carefully weigh the interests of both parties in finding the best-fitting solutions.
When someone cannot return to their old (or adjusted) position with their current employer, and a new workplace must be found at another employer, this is called a second track process.
